The Boston Bruins will try to complete a season-series sweep in two marquee matchups to bookend the first full week of March. They will try to avoid a sweep in a time-honored divisional feud later in the month.
Overall, out of their 25 games separating the NHL’s Olympic break from the playoffs, the Bruins will engage an Atlantic Division opponent nine times. In five cases, the opponent in question should still be in playoff contention.
Elsewhere, they will have another nine engagements with teams in the gridlocked Metropolitan Division. Although, one of those teams may have the means to distance itself from the clutter of uncertainty as it has found its rhythm since its last bout with Boston.
Among seven nonconference clashes, one will feature a familiar foe in the 10th-to-final game of the regular season.
